Gorō Naya (納谷悟朗) was a Japanese actor, voice actor, narrator, and theater director.  He is most famous for voicing Inspector Kōichi Zenigata in the "Lupin III" anime series, and for his Japanese voice-overs of roles played by Clark Gable, Charlton Heston, and John Wayne.  He died in 2013 due to chronic respiratory failure.
